Do homicide detectives work by shift or crime?

In most jurisdictions the case is assigned to a detective, known as the lead detective for that case. That detective will manage the case according to his needs and the priority in which that crime must be solved. Detectives normally work by shift, but maybe called in on a homicide case, on a case-by-case basis. The detective Lieut. will assign the case to a lead detective, who will delegate certain tasks of the case to other detectives (for example, the lead detective may interview witnesses while another detective may notify the family or assist in processing the crime scene).

Who is a fictional LA police detective?

One example of a fictional LA police detective is Harry Bosch, a character created by author Michael Connelly. Bosch is a relentless and dedicated detective who works for the LAPD homicide division and is known for his sharp intuition and unyielding pursuit of justice.
